Page made with pictures of our grandson visiting Callantsoog. Big machines at work. A ship is getting sand of the bottom of the sea and a pipeline is transporting it to the beach. This is why...
The dunes and beaches are our main protection against the sea. Because of wind, sea and flow, sand disappears from the coast. Beaches become smaller by rising sea levels. By applying new sand, the coastline will remain intact in a natural way. 12 million square meters additional sand strenthens the coastline annuallly. http://www.rws.nl/water/waterbeheer/bescherming-tegen-het-water/maatregelen-om-overstromingen-te-voorkomen/kustonderhoud (in Dutch)
